Continuous Domains in Formal Concept Analysis*

Formal Concept Analysis (FCA) has been proven to be an effective method of restructuring complete lattices and various algebraic domains. In this paper, the notion contractive mappings over formal contexts is proposed, which can viewed as a generalization interior operators on sets into framework FCA. Formal Concept Analysis and Resolution in Algebraic Domains — Preliminary Report

We relate two formerly independent areas: Formal concept analysis and logic of domains. We will establish a correspondene between contextual attribute logic on formal contexts resp. concept lattices and a clausal logic on coherent algebraic cpos. We show how to identify the notion of formal concept in the domain theoretic setting. In particular, we show that a special instance of the resolution...

Scalability in Formal Concept Analysis

Formal Concept Analysis is a symbolic learning technique derived from mathematical algebra and order theory. The technique has been applied to a broad range of knowledge representation and exploration tasks in a variety of domains. Most recorded applications of formal concept analysis deal with a small number of objects and attributes, in which case the complexity of the algorithms used for ind...
